How Does South Jordan, UT Spend Tax Money?

South Jordan, UT spends $10,392 per resident, with total expenditures of $811.8M. Top spending categories: Parks & Recreation ($607/person), Fire Protection ($330/person), Highways & Roads ($154/person). Fiscal Health Score: B (65/100).
